#63f822 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63f822 is composed of 38.8% red, 97.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 101.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 55.3%. #63f822 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ff44 with #00f100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#63f822 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63f822 has RGB values of R:99, G:248,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6551586.

Shades and Tints of #63f822
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020700 is the darkest color, while #f7fff3 is the lightest one.
